Sustainability collection

Sustainable development is usually defined as "development that meet the needs of the present without compromising the ability of future generations to meet their own needs." (Gro Harlem Brundtland in the UN report "Our Common Future", 1987)

The sustainability collection covers all three dimensions of the concept: ecological, economic and social sustainability. The collection includes both non-fiction and fiction. The sustainability shelf is located on the second floor outside the Compactus shelves.
